Absolutely loved this campground. It's right across the highway from the ocean side, and from a few campsites in the campground you can actually see and hear the ocean through the trees. Decent size campground that is well kept with potable water and bathrooms (no running sink water). Lots of beautiful trees and some open area. Our campground had a campfire pit and also a separate standing grill you can use charcoal with. Our grounds keepers also provided firewood bundles for $15, and an optional fire starter for $5 that worked really well.
Our grounds keepers were amazing and very attentive, informative, and so helpful. Shout out Michael and Punky, you guys made the trip for us. Very positive energy and availability to the campers. They recommended a couple spots for sight seeing and hiking, including Kirk Creek Trail which we hiked all the way up to the flats which was fantastic. Wish I could have stayed longer!

Beautiful campground, with mature trees. Any complaints about bathroom cleanliness has more to do with fellow male campers (consistently not lifting seat to pee! ugh!) than cleaning routine by campground staff. Campground was probably more quiet than usual with the road closed north of the campground.
Access to the beach was easy. we were there fairly early in the season, so trail maintenance was underway to clear back a LOT of poison oak. Beautiful beaches. Friendly and helpful camp hosts.
